Electrical, Electronics, and Communications Engineering at University of Utah

Ranked 23rd of 129 bachelor's programs in Electrical, Electronics, and Communications Engineering by 5-year earnings.

Median · 1 year out
$81,111
middle 50%: $68,659 – $95,977
Median · 5 years out
$105,672
middle 50%: $90,722 – $130,636
Median · 10 years out
$137,440
middle 50%: $118,256 – $175,548

Salary trajectory

Median earnings vs the national median for Electrical, Electronics, and Communications Engineering (bachelor's) graduates.

This program (median)National median, same major & degreeMiddle 50% of graduates

Electrical and Communications Engineering graduates earn $81k in their first year. By year ten, median salaries reach $137k.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au PSEO, release V4.13.0 2025Q4. Earnings are for graduates working in covered states; figures are medians in nominal dollars.
